The Minister of Economy called on major suppliers of socially significant goods to lower prices

On November 17, Minister of Economy and Commerce Bakyt Sydykov held a meeting with the largest domestic suppliers of socially significant goods. Representatives of the tax service of all four districts of Bishkek also participated in the meeting.

The minister emphasized the need to review the pricing policy for a number of key goods on which social stability directly depends.

"We are actively working with chain hypermarkets and markets in the capital. We are already seeing understanding on their part and the first results in terms of price reductions. However, since we are talking about the entire supply chain, it is necessary to review pricing proposals comprehensively. This is being done in the interests of citizens. We are not asking them to operate at a loss — we are simply asking them to approach pricing sensibly,“ said Sydykov.

He also reported that the Antimonopoly Regulation Service has stepped up its monitoring of the market situation.

”In the last two days alone, more than 30 fines have been imposed," the minister noted.

The Ministry of Economy and Commerce, together with the Antimonopoly Regulation Service, will continue to monitor price dynamics to ensure the stability of the consumer market and protect the interests of the population.
